    George Kittle Injury Update: What to Know About 49ers TE Status Ahead of Week 18

    George Kittle has been a foundational piece to the San Francisco 49ers for as long as head coach Kyle Shanahan has been around. At 32 years old, there is no guarantee how long he will play. However, he is all-in for at least one more run if his body allows.

    Nevertheless, his health has taken a dip down the stretch of the regular season, putting his availability in question for an NFC West and top-seed-deciding confrontation with the Seattle Seahawks. Here’s what you need to know about the tight end and whether the 49ers can count on him in Week 18.

    What Happened to George Kittle?

    George Kittle is recovering from an ankle injury that kept him out of Week 17 against the Chicago Bears. According to the NBC broadcast, Kittle has been battling swelling in his ankle. The swelling acted up before the Bears’ contest, which kept him out.

    Kittle missed every practice in the buildup to the game against the Bears, according to the official 49ers injury report. Regardless of his hopes and intentions, it sets the stage for a big question this week.

    Is George Kittle Playing Week 18?

    At this point, the tight end is questionable for the contest. The San Francisco 49ers have not yet held a practice in Week 18. For Kittle to play, he will need to log time during the week at practice. Whether it is three limited practices or a DNP/LP/FP regimen, San Francisco will need to see something to get any hope of a fully usable Kittle.

    The contest against the Seattle Seahawks takes place on Saturday, which sets up the 49ers for one of the shortest weeks in the NFL in Week 18, making things more difficult on the tight end. Considering the importance of the game with the difference between the top seed in the NFC and a wildcard on the line, Kittle will do everything to get on the field, even if he’s less than 100% healthy.

    As such, the odds seem well above 50% that he gets on the field. Whether he finishes the game or is fully available to do everything is anyone’s guess.
